"Caspian, Are we almost there?"
"Soon Cass, Stop fidgeting!" I scold playfully towards my little sister. We went into town this morning for a special present for my mother's banquet this weekend. I had a few guards accompany us but didn't want my parents to know of this trip. I wanted it to be a surprise but then my sister found out as I was about to leave. I allowed her to come along... however now I regret that decision. She is truly delicate and knows no dangers of this world.
She currently has her long pitch black hair weaved into a delicate braid around her head. Her soft fingers playing with the hem of one layers of her dress. She is truly a miracle sent to my parents. After having me, they were told my mother would not be able to carry again. They were upset however never gave up hope. Cassandra came along and my parents told me she was my angel to look after. That is how I viewed my sister from a young age. She huffs and crosses her arms giving me an adorable pout. I couldn't help but softly chuckle at.
My train of thoughts come to abrupt halt when our carriage stops suddenly. I know we are still to far from the palace, I glance at the window but all I see is the dead bodies of my soldiers. I gently pull my sword out of it's sheath but our door is yanked open. Men start pulling on myself and my sister making her cry out. I try to remain calm however my blood boils seeing them treat her like this. She is crying my name so I gently tell her that everything will be okay even though I am not sure. They pull us off the trail and into the dense forest. My sister's whimpering the only sound I can register. They throw both of us to the ground in a small clearing. My sister jumps into my arms and I secure my arms around her letting her cry into my chest. I look around to see the men circling us looking at us grinning smugly. I am a good swordsmen however I know I can not protect my sister while disarming 6 men. I need to start forming a plan.

"Well, well, well.. Is that Prince Caspian?" The man taunts in front of me. I look up and don't recognize the man coming closer to us. I gently push my sister behind me where she holds my cloak for dear life.
"I don't think we have had the pleasure." I say with a level voice raising my chin up.
"Oh trust me, we haven't met before regardless you won't ever forget me." He chuckles lowly. I pull Cassandra tighter to my back. His men begin laughing at my attempts to hide her. I narrow my eyes at them while they begin stepping closer to us. The leader raising his sword pointing at my throat.
"Let them go, Dante."
I whip my head to see a small boy standing the clearing with blonde hair and a green cloak hanging from his shoulders. He isn't very tall however he holds his stance well. He doesn't seem to be more than Cassandra's age, maybe 12 at most. I abruptly turn my head back hearing the man holding the sword to my throat chuckling with a sinister grin.
"Oh, poor boy, what are you go to do about it?" The yellow teeth gleam as he begins stalking towards the boy who does not look the least bit fazed. I look around at the other men who are following the leader. I pull Cassandra tighter to my back as I take small steps back. I keep my eye trained on the men but also fear for the naive boy.
"Do you really want to test me Dante?" He asks raising a single eyebrow. For a minute the men stop their movements. I see their hesitation for fear... Fear of what? I take the moment to stick Cassandra behind a nearby tree. She crouches down while I pull my sword out from its place.
"How do you know my name?" The scoundrel raises his sword challenging towards the boy before taking a final step towards him. Then the unexpected happens. The young boy chuckles so darkly. It sounded almost... demonic. All the men instinctively raise their swords.
"Oh Dante, I didn't know your name... but you know someone dear to me."
"Spit it out boy!" The once grinning man is now looking around frantically. I continue my eyes scanning the small boy. He looks directly at me and gives me a small nod before saying one word that caused all hell to breaks loose.

"Artemis."
I hear a whistling sound through the air before the leader drops to the ground on his back with an arrow in his head. Perfect shot. I look around but the snarling of wolves making me look back at the young man. The other 5 men begin swinging their swords around however once again I hear the whistling of an arrow in the air. Another man drops dead. I continue to be frozen in my spot until I see a cloaked figure drop from a tree. Other than the lady-like figure, I can't see anything about her. She begins softly humming and the wolves gather around the pair. They all seem to be following her lead. She continues to hum until one the men lunge for her making her draw out a sword from underneath her cloak. She quickly strikes him dropping him to the ground. The other men then jump into action and she whistles. All the wolves begin attacking the remaining men. I stand there watching with an erratic beating heart. She wields her sword better than anyone I have ever seen. After a few minutes all is silent. All six men... dead.
The cloaked figure runs her blood covered blade along her cloak cleaning it before holstering her sword. The wolves all look to her and she leans down placing her hand to one particular wolf. I couldn't move, I couldn't breathe. She directs her head towards me but I still can't see her face. She nods once and then turns towards the small boy. She walks up to him and places her forehead to his. He grumbles out something before walking over to me. I instinctively hold the hilt of my sword tighter. The wolf that is walking along with him growls warning and I release my sword. The young boy stands in front of me. He glances back at the figure and she nods her head. He huffs and looks down before grumbling.
"Would you like for us to accompany you back to your gates?"
I look back at the masked figure. Whomever she is, she is not coming closer making me wonder what she is hiding. I didn't know what they were wanting but I was grateful for their assistance a few minutes ago. I look back down but notice the young man is no longer standing there. I whip my head around seeing him reach his hand out to my sister. She takes it pulling herself up before running into my arms. I hold her tight as she shakes and whimpers clinging to me. I see the young boy looking towards his companion and see his facial features scrunch. I look back towards the cloak figure who begins walking away with the wolves following her. I notice one stays with the young lad.
"What is your name?"
"Navene, sir." He says before walking back towards our carriage. I pick up my sister and follow behind him. I continue to look towards the wolf that is walking along with him. I have never seen a wolf be friendly towards us. It was very interesting see this interaction.
"That's not fair... but I can- fine!" He grumbles out crossing his arms. I look up noticing the cloaked lady stroking the horses. Upon getting closer I can hear her soft voice singly angelically to the horses seeming to calm them. "I will drive you both, you will be safe."
I nod and push Cassandra's face into my neck not wanting her to see the bodies surrounding the carriage. I'm about to climb in when I stop and turn towards the cloaked figure.
"Ma'm, would you like to ride inside with us?" She doesn't answer just turns around and begins walking with several wolves following. I continue to watch her walk farther away. I hear the young boy, Navene, chuckle and look up at him as his eyes stay trained on her.
"She request you stop staring at her." My eyes go wide as saucers looking back at her and then back at him.
"How did-"
"Sir, we need to get moving." He says abruptly cutting me off from questioning him. I walk into the carriage and continue holding Cassandra who has now calm down and tired herself out. I feel the carriage take off and some many thoughts begin racing through my mind.
All belonging to certain cloaked woman.
